Output e8e80de6561917a30f7c87263e4cdd146c428c697498d104bd66130334c27cb9:1

value
4143353
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8427bb6df62e8ae486b5b263ccfdbd148b6b66d3 OP_EQUALVERIFY OP_CHECKSIG
address
1D3mnxexnZknL6ZuLSHcPymjEAR8oMyL6K
transaction
e8e80de6561917a30f7c87263e4cdd146c428c697498d104bd66130334c27cb9
spent
true